MARKET INSIGHTS
Global cyanoacrylate sealant market size was valued at USD 1.42 billion in 2025 and is projected to grow from USD 1.51 billion in 2026 to USD 2.26 billion by 2034, exhibiting a CAGR of 6.9% during the forecast period.
Cyanoacrylate sealants are fast‑acting adhesives that polymerize rapidly in the presence of moisture to form strong, durable bonds. These industrial‑grade adhesives are categorized into different viscosity grades (501, 502, 504, 661, etc.) and find applications across medical, automotive, electronics, and general industrial sectors. Their ability to bond diverse materials including metals, plastics, and rubbers makes them indispensable in modern manufacturing.
The market growth is driven by expanding applications in medical device assembly and electronics miniaturization, where precision bonding is critical. While the automotive sector remains a key consumer for panel bonding and component assembly, emerging opportunities in aerospace composites and renewable energy installations are creating new demand pockets. However, volatility in raw material prices and environmental regulations regarding VOC emissions present ongoing challenges for manufacturers.

MARKET DRIVERS
Rising Demand from the Automotive and Electronics Industries
The global cyanoacrylate sealant market is witnessing sustained growth, primarily propelled by its extensive adoption in the automotive and electronics sectors. These industries value the product’s rapid curing time, high bond strength on various substrates, and excellent resistance to environmental factors. In automotive manufacturing, cyanoacrylates are essential for bonding interior trim, mirrors, and lightweight components. The ongoing trend toward vehicle lightweighting to improve fuel efficiency creates a continuous demand for high‑performance adhesives that can replace mechanical fasteners.
Advancements in Product Formulations
Technological innovation has led to the development of advanced cyanoacrylate formulations that address earlier limitations, such as brittleness and poor impact resistance. Manufacturers have introduced toughened and flexible grades, as well as low‑odor and surface‑insensitive variants, which significantly expand the range of potential applications. Furthermore, the development of medical‑grade cyanoacrylates, approved for topical wound closure, has opened up a high‑value segment in the healthcare industry.

MARKET CHALLENGES
Handling and Shelf‑Life Limitations
A significant challenge facing the cyanoacrylate sealant market is the product’s inherent sensitivity to moisture, which initiates the curing process. This characteristic demands strict control over storage conditions and packaging to prevent premature polymerization, ultimately affecting shelf life. For end‑users, especially in industrial settings, this can lead to material waste and increased costs if not managed carefully. The requirement for specialized storage can be a logistical hurdle for distributors and large‑scale consumers.
Other Challenges
Performance Limitations on Certain Substrates
While excellent on many materials, cyanoacrylates can exhibit poor adhesion on acidic or porous surfaces, and the resulting bonds can be brittle, making them unsuitable for applications requiring high peel or impact strength. This limits their use in some demanding industrial environments.
Health and Safety Concerns
Handling cyanoacrylates requires caution due to potential skin bonding and eye irritation risks. These health concerns necessitate the use of personal protective equipment (PPE) and comprehensive safety protocols in professional settings, adding a layer of complexity to their use compared to some alternative adhesives.
MARKET RESTRAINTS
Price Volatility of Raw Materials
The production of cyanoacrylate adhesives is heavily dependent on key raw materials derived from petrochemicals. Fluctuations in the prices of crude oil and natural gas directly impact the cost of these feedstocks, leading to instability in the manufacturing costs for sealant producers. This price volatility can squeeze profit margins and make long‑term pricing strategies difficult, potentially restraining market growth. Manufacturers are often forced to absorb these costs or pass them on to customers, which can affect demand in price‑sensitive market segments.
Competition from Alternative Technologies
The market faces strong competition from other high‑performance adhesive technologies, such as epoxy resins, polyurethane adhesives, and silicone sealants. These alternatives often offer superior properties for specific applications, such as higher temperature resistance, greater flexibility, or better gap‑filling capabilities. The availability of these substitutes presents a significant restraint, as customers may opt for products that offer a broader performance profile, limiting the market share for cyanoacrylates in certain industrial applications.

COMPETITIVE LANDSCAPE
Key Industry Players
A Market Dominated by Global Chemical Giants and Specialized Adhesive Manufacturers
The global cyanoacrylate sealant market is characterized by a high degree of consolidation, with a few multinational corporations holding significant market share. Henkel AG (Germany), with its iconic Loctite brand, is widely recognized as the global leader. Its extensive product portfolio, robust R&D capabilities, and unparalleled global distribution network provide a formidable competitive edge. 3M (US) and DuPont (US) are other major players, leveraging their strong brand reputation and technological expertise across multiple industrial segments to capture substantial market value. These leaders compete intensely on product innovation, application‑specific formulations, and global supply chain efficiency, creating a relatively high barrier to entry for new participants.
Beyond the dominant players, the market includes several well‑established specialized manufacturers and regional competitors that cater to specific niches or geographic areas. Companies like Bostik SA (France) offer alternative adhesive technologies but maintain a presence in cyanoacrylates, particularly in construction and packaging applications. Specialized manufacturers such as Permabond (Ellsworth Adhesives) and Parson Adhesives focus on high‑performance industrial grades and technical support for specialized applications in aerospace, electronics, and medical device assembly. Emerging market players often compete by offering cost‑effective solutions, targeting specific regional distribution channels, or developing formulations for less‑served application areas.

Global Cyanoacrylate Sealant Market Trends
Sustained Growth Driven by Demand in Medical and Electronics Sectors
The global cyanoacrylate sealant market is experiencing steady growth, primarily fueled by their extensive and increasing application in the medical and electronics industries. In the medical field, cyanoacrylates are critical for wound closure, tissue adhesives, and surgical procedures, offering advantages over traditional sutures such as reduced application time and lower risk of infection. The rise in surgical procedures worldwide and the demand for minimally invasive techniques are key drivers. Simultaneously, the electronics sector utilizes these sealants for potting, encapsulation, and bonding miniature components due to their rapid curing times and excellent adhesion to plastics and metals, which is essential for manufacturing smartphones, wearables, and other consumer electronics.
Other Trends
Product Innovation and High‑Performance Formulations
Market leaders like Henkel AG and 3M are heavily investing in R&D to develop advanced formulations. This includes creating cyanoacrylates with enhanced properties such as improved temperature resistance, flexibility, and low‑odor variants. There is a significant trend towards developing medical‑grade products that meet stringent biocompatibility standards (e.g., ISO 10993) and industrial‑grade products that can withstand harsh environmental conditions, expanding their applicability in automotive and aerospace industries.
